Correspondingly, how does soil compaction affect plant growth?
Soil compaction increases soil density. Roots are less able to penetrate the soil and are generally shallow and malformed. Because their growth is restricted, they're less able to exploit the soil for nutrients and moisture.
How does water affect soil compaction?
Effect of Water Content on Compaction of Soil At low water content, the soil is stiff and offers more resistance to compaction. As the water content is increased, the soil particles get lubricated. Thus the higher dry density is achieved upto the optimum water content due to forcing air voids out from the soil voids.

Compaction purposes and processes Compaction is a process of increasing soil density and removing air, usually by mechanical means. The size of the individual soil particles does not change, neither is water removed. Purposeful compaction is intended to improve the strength and stiffness of soil.How do you stabilize soil?

What are the different methods of compaction?
The method of compaction is primarily of four types such as kneading, static, dynamic or impact and vibratory compaction. Different type of action is effective in different type of soils such as for cohesive soils; sheepsfoot rollers or pneumatic rollers provide the kneading action.Which soil type is most subject to compaction?

Is farming good for soil?
Agriculture alters the natural cycling of nutrients in soil. Intensive cultivation and harvesting of crops for human or animal consumption can effectively mine the soil of plant nutrients. In order to maintain soil fertility for sufficient crop yields, soil amendments are typically required.How does farming impact soil?
